Geological & Earth Sciences is the 95th most popular major in the country with 7,821 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, geological and earth sciences gra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$38,705 and had an average of $23,383 in loans still to pay off.

Across Texas, there were 675 geological and earth s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$48,639 and $20,113 respectively.

This year’s “Most Well Attended Geology Major in Texas” ranking looked at 40 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in geological and earth sciences. This ranking identifies schools that graduate the most students in geological and earth sciences.
